• Foruma hoş geldin 👋 Ziyaretçi

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ak tamamen ücretsizdir.

Çözüldü Son Dolu Textbox'u Temizleme

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

Sahin01

Yeni Üye
Kullanıcı Bilgileri
Aktiflik
Çevrimdışı
Katılım
30 Eyl 2022
Mesajlar
70
Çözümler
6
Aldığı beğeni
32
Excel V
Office 2016 TR
Konuyu Başlatan
Sitede ve internette arama yaptım ancak bulduğum her kod bütün textbox'ları temizliyor. Benim istediğim listboxtan veri çektiğim yan yana ve alt alta sıralı olan textboxların son dolu olanlarının içeriğini silmek.

Private Sub Textbox1_Enter()
TextBox1 = ""
End Sub

Şeklinde textbox'un enter olayına tanımlanabilir ancak bunu bir butonla yapmak istersek son dolu textbox'u/textbox'ları nasıl silebiliriz. Yardımcı olması adına örnek bir çalışma ekledim yardımcı olabileceklere şimdiden çok teşekkür ederim.
 

Ekli dosyalar

  • Örnek.xlsm
    51.7 KB · Gösterim: 5
Merhaba,
Birden fazla textbox ta veri var ama siz sadece sonuncuyu mu silmek istiyorsunuz,yoksa dolu olan text leri mi ?
 
Sayın Ali ÖZ listbox'tan tıklayarak textbox'lara veri çekiyorum, yapmak istediğim listboxtan veri gelen son dolu textboxları (Ürün ve Birim) temizlemek. Tıkladıkça alttan yukarıya doğru son dolu textboxun içeriğini temizlemek istiyorum.
 
Maalesef dolu olan bütün textboxları temizledi ve listboxa tıklayınca temizlenen yerden sonra veri ekliyor.

Şöyle örneklendirim: Örneğin alt alta 3-5-10 tane textbox'a veri çektim (doldurulacak textbox sayısı değişken) ancak son dolu olanı yanlış seçtim, temizle butonuna basınca sadece son dolu olan textboxu temizlesin. Ben listboxa tekrar tıklayınca kalan yerden alt alta veri eklenmeye devam etsin.
 
Şöyle bir kod buldum ancak en üstten silmeye başlıyor ve listboxtan veri çekmek istediğinde temizlenen textboxlardan sonra veri ekliyor, sanırım listbox click olayı temizlenen textboxları dolu görüyor. Bu kodu alttan sildirip listboxtaki hatayı nasıl düzeltebiliriz.

Kod:
Değerli Misafirimiz İçeriği Görebilmek İçin Üyemiz İseniz Giriş Yap'ın Ya da Üye Ol'un.
 
Sayın Ali ÖZ maalesef önce birimleri yukarı doğru sonra ürünleri yukarı doğru temizliyor. Satır olarak temizlemesi gerekti ve haala listbox aktarımını temizlenen yerden sonra başlatıyor.
 
Sayın Alicimri çok teşekkür ederim elinize sağlık. Sizede çok teşekkür ederim sayın Ali ÖZ , textboxları temizleme sorununu çözdük.

Ayrı bir başlıktamı sorsam bilemedim. Şuan listboxa tıkladığımda örneğin 2 satır textbox sildiysem oraları boş bırakıp öyle alttan veri ekliyor. Ve sil dediğimde de üstteki boşluktan başlayıp siliyor ve sonra hata veriyor.
 

Ekli dosyalar

  • Örnek.jpg
    Örnek.jpg
    126.8 KB · Gösterim: 2
Dosyada biraz değişiklik yaptım, deneyin.
 

Ekli dosyalar

  • Örnek.xlsm
    33.3 KB · Gösterim: 5
Çözüm
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st